NEW YORK, NY – New York City Police are searching for a suspect who was caught on camera after robbing a 38-year-old woman at the West 4th Street E-Train on February 11th. In video provided today by the NYPD, the suspect can be seen exiting the train and looking back at his victim as he went toward the stairwell. The incident happened at 9:35 am when he displayed a knife and demanded the woman give her property to him. If you can help identify the suspect, call 800-577-TIPS. The NYPD says there is a reward of up to $3,500.
